Job Description

Mechanical Supervisor - Liverpool
6 Month Contract

An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Mechanical Supervisor to join a M&E Contractor on a commercial project in Liverpool.

Job Purpose: The responsibilities of this Mechanical Site Supervisor role include overseeing mechanical work and site trades, scoping work and ordering materials, issuing permits, and ensuring safety rules are followed.

Role:

  1. Co-ordination of the installation.
  2. Supervising Contractors and Subcontractors, ensuring all direct staff and Subcontractors are adequately trained and adhering to H&S procedures.
  3. Conducting toolbox talks, ordering materials, completing schedules of work, scheduling materials to ensure programme of works delivered.
  4. Liaise with Managers on a regular basis, reporting on any and all works conducted on site.
  5. Managing variations.
  6. Ensuring the quality of the installation was of a high standard.
  7. Carrying out site surveys.
  8. Ensuring the installation was snag-free.
  9. Paperwork management; RFI's, method statements, risk assessments, site diaries, progress reports.

Requirements:

  1. City and Guilds NVQ Level 3 in Plumbing/Pipefitting or equivalent.
  2. CSCS.
  3. SSSTS/SMSTS.
  4. Good literacy skills.
  5. Previous experience in a Supervisory/Management role.
  6. Previous experience of working on infrastructure projects.
